How they compare
Cameroon currently reports 67.3% against 65.1% in Guatemala, a difference of 2.2%.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 7 shared years of data; in 2012 it was Cameroon ahead.
Cameroon ranks 19th and Guatemala ranks 22nd of 179 countries.
Across the 2 decades both report, Cameroon averaged higher in 1 and Guatemala in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Cameroon | Guatemala |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2010s | 58.3% | 61.4% | 3.1% | Guatemala |
| 2020s | 66.2% | 63.9% | 2.3% | Cameroon |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
